Output e48c15d3f2c1b63e24bc109b2c670f20a40a1147be9128d58109cc29f6cd672a:4

value
38376500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 925e69e6e9887f1a3316f9e9f928ae68251e8248 OP_EQUAL
address
MMF5zR1yJd3vB5DUnYkP3Yr16bbbPMbcFs
transaction
e48c15d3f2c1b63e24bc109b2c670f20a40a1147be9128d58109cc29f6cd672a
spent
true